{"version":"0.3.0","atoms":[],"cards":[],"markups":[["strong"]],"sections":[[1,"p",[[0,[0],1,"Comments"]]],[1,"p",[[0,[],0,"The Mars and Rhythm addition as a composition unto itself is clean, dynamic, and interestingly ordered \u2013 and perhaps adds a more compelling and relative veneer onto the page-west existing facility. More reference to context could have been offered, but there is a very legible order to the massing, a unified material palette, and an intentional introduction of material contrasts. The glazed brick gives the metal panel a nice textural counterpoint, and bringing it inside was a savvy decision. Interiors are beautifully balanced, and furnishings, lighting and textures are well-executed. Excellent design decisions were made at multiple scales, and little moments hidden everywhere. The patio spaces at the street and upper levels are thoughtfully designed, and the stair is well done. It\u2019s obvious that time and effort were put into the design choices."]]]]}

[{"body":{"version":"0.3.0","atoms":[],"cards":[],"markups":[["strong"]],"sections":[[1,"p",[[0,[0],1,"Program Statement:"]]],[1,"p",[[0,[],0,"A sleek and bold intervention into\nthe cultural core of Downtown Huntsville, Mars Music Hall at the Von Braun\nCenter opened on January 3rd, 2020. With a capacity of\n1,500 patrons in a standing room only configuration, Mars is expected to bring\nanother tier of acts and performances to North Alabama, as there was no\nappropriately sized venue in this market previously. Mars Music Hall\nfeatures a fixed stage with sound and lights, standing or seated G.A. area, as\nwell as a mezzanine level for VIP experiences. Multiple bars are located\nwithin the performance area, so those in attendance need not miss out on any of\nthe performance while waiting in line for beverages. In addition to the music\nhall, the project also showcases Rhythm on Monroe, a full-service restaurant\nand rooftop bar. Rhythm on Monroe not only provides pre-function food\nservice to those attending VBC events, it also offers a new dining and\nrooftop experience for the general public on the edge of downtown."]]]]},"title":""}]
